WebDec 24, 2024 · For set-in stains: Use the side of a spoon to scrape off any crusty bits from the fabric. Apply a mild liquid laundry detergent directly on to the stain and rub it in with your fingers. Fill a sink or bucket with cool water and soak the jeans for about 30 minutes. WebApr 12, 2012 · Yes, they are. Douse the stain with white vinegar, then apply a paste made of equal parts baking soda and vinegar. If this doesn't work, immerse the item overnight in a bucket of water containing a few tablespoons of detergent and vinegar. Rinse and wash the following morning. WebMar 15, 2024 · Baking soda: Sprinkle baking soda on the grease stain and wait 10 to 15 minutes while it soaks up the grease. Brush or scrape off the baking soda. Sprinkle on more if there's still grease on the jeans and repeat the process. Dish detergent: Most dish soap is designed to break up grease, making it an easy solution for grease stains on jeans.

WebOct 13, 2024 · Remove any excess oil with a paper towel or cloth. Sprinkle baking soda on the affected fabric and allow it to sit for 24 hours. After a day passes, vacuum or brush the baking soda away. Spray the affected area with a vinegar and water solution. Scrub with soap and a brush, then rinse.
